kstars was 'ported' to the Sharp Zaurus, you might start looking for those 
sources. I am fairly sure it uses 'microkde' or 'minikde' sources.


On Tuesday 26 September 2006 07:18, Yan Seiner wrote:
> I've been thinking of embedding kstars http://edu.kde.org/kstars/ on a
> PC104 board.  Could someone give me a few pointers on how to go about it?
>
> flash space is not a big issue, so the question is, how extensive are
> the changes?  Or should I just compile kdelibs against Qt/e and hope for
> the best?
